, Souness denied that he had been unfair to Pogba, acknowledging that he is “extremely talented” but that he is more interested in showing “the world how cute and clever” he is rather than dominating opponents. He said he was the “kind of individual wrecks your club” before applying the coup de grace of saying he was “a lazy twat”.
Now, Pogba and Manchester United were not a roaring success, either first time around or second. That can be agreed, although it is possible to argue all night about who is to blame for the clown show at Old Trafford.
It is fair to treat him as other footballers are treated but Souness’ view of him runs dangerously close to a character assassination, which leaves you asking how well he or any of us really know Pogba. Is he a waster? Is he misunderstood? How many people have got into his head? And when it comes to it, is the accusation of laziness itself a lazy trope? There is a history of black footballers being stereotyped in that way, as Ron Atkinson, the former Manchester United manager turned television pundit, infamously did with Marcel Desailly in 2004. Atkinson called Desailly, one of the most successful footballers of recent years, “thick” and “lazy” before using a racially offensive epithet.
It is not as if Souness is not alive to sensitivities around language and race.
